Installing a CD/DVD Drive

 

1.

Unpack the drive and prepare it for installation.

Check the documentation that accompanied the drive to verify that the drive is configured for your computer. If you are installing an IDE drive, configure
the drive for the cable select setting.

 

2.

If you are installing a new drive:

a.

 

Press the two snaps on the top of the drive-panel insert and rotate the insert toward the front of the computer.

b.

 

Remove the three shoulder screws from the drive-panel insert.

c.

 

Insert the three shoulder screws into the sides of the new drive and tighten them.

 

3.

If you are replacing an existing drive:

a.

 

Remove the three shoulder screws from the existing drive.

b.

 

Insert the three shoulder screws into the sides of the new drive and tighten them.

 

4.

Connect the power and data cables to the drive.

 

5.

Align the shoulder screws with the screw guides, and slide the drive into the bay until it clicks into place.

NOTICE:

Do not pull the drive out of the computer by the drive cables. Doing so may cause damage to cables and the cable connectors.
